HIV Tat Induces Expression of ICAM-1 in HUVECs: Implications for miR-221/-222 in HIV-Associated Cardiomyopathy
Cardiac involvement is a well-documented complication of human immunodeficiency virus-1 (HIV-1) infection. Previous studies have demonstrated increased adhesion of monocytes to human vascular endothelial cells in HIV-infected individuals. HIV Tat protein, which is the transactivator of transcription...
